Section 14-118-309 - Hearing of complaints against assessment - Appeal

(a) Any owner of real property within the district who conceives himself to be aggrieved by the assessment of benefits or damages or deems that the assessment of any lands in the district is inadequate shall present his complaint to the circuit court on the day named in the notice.(b) The court shall consider the complaint and enter its findings thereon, either confirming the assessment or increasing or diminishing it.(c) The court's findings shall have the force and effect of a judgment, from which an appeal may be taken to the Supreme Court of Arkansas within thirty (30) days, either by the property owner or by the commissioners of the district.Acts 1983, No. 432, § 5; A.S.A. 1947, § 21-1028.
